Resumo: |
We present a general introduction in the construction of experimental design, spe- cially a general factorial design and factorial design 2k and some Bayesian criteria in the construction of experimental design. In practice, usually the researcher can have a priori knowledge of specialists for estimated quantities from an experiment. The use of Bayesian methods can take on best results with low costs. Many Bayesian criteria in- troduced in literature are presented. One of the main applications in the experimental design construction involve the existance of linear trends with objective of verifying the best sequence of runs, specially the factorial designs with eight runs. In this disertation, we introduce some basic concepts in design of experiments and the use of the Bayesian approach to have more e¢ cient and less cost experiments. The main goal of the work, is to consider a special case of great importance in applied indistrial work: the presence of linear trend. In this case, we present a comparative study in design of experiments under the classical and Bayesian approaches. |
